Processor: AMD Ryzen 5 5500U | Speed: 2.1 GHz (Base) – 4.0 GHz (Max) | 6 Cores | 12 Threads | 3MB L2 & 8MB L3 Cache
OS: Pre-Loaded Windows 11 Home with Lifetime Validity | Pre-Installed: Office Home 2024
Memory and Storage: 8GB RAM DDR4, Upgradable up to 16GB | 512 GB SSD
Display: 15.6″ FHD (1920×1080) | Brightness :220nits | Anti-Glare | 45% NTSC || Graphics: Integrated AMD Radeon Graphics
Audio: 2x 1.5W Stereo Speakers | HD Audio | Dolby AudioCamera: HD 720p with Privacy Shutter | Fixed Focus | Integrated Dual Array Microphone
Ports: 1x USB-A 3.2 Gen 1 | 1x USB-A 2.0 | 1x USB-C 3.2 Gen 1 (Data transfer) | 1x 3.5mm Headphone/Mic combo jack | 1x HDMI 1.4b | 1x 4-in-1 media reader (MMC, SD, SDHC, SDXC)
Battery Life: 42Wh | Upto 9 Hours | Rapid Charge (Up to 80% in 1 Hour)
Design: 4 Side narrow bezel | 1.9 cm Thin and 1.6 kg Light
Warranty: This genuine Lenovo laptop comes with 1 year onsite manufacturer warranty and 1 Year Accidental Damage Protection

Nikhilesh Bhala –
Great hardware. Only drawback is poor durability and cheap plastic body.
i.) I don’t know why people are cribbing so much about the screen. The laptops which have an IPS display with a similar configuration (and 15.6″ screens) are mostly over Rs. 55000. You get what you pay for. If needing an IPS display because you’re too lazy to occasionally adjust the screen is worth Rs.10000 more, be my guest. The screen and display are absolutely fine otherwise (yes, you can watch movies and everything else).ii.) This is one of the only few models in this price range which has a backlit keyboard. If an IPS display truly matters though, you do have some Lenovo, Acer and HP laptops which are <45000. I'm not sure if they have backlit keyboards though.iii.) The only issue I have (and this applies to all other brands) is the fact that almost all the newer laptop models have really small Up and Down arrow keys which can initially be inconvenient if you use them a lot. In the beginning, my fingers were getting cramped up due to that. It takes a bit of time to get used to them. It's completely fine once you get used to it. However, if you want standard sized arrow keys, get another model. The laptop works smoothly otherwise and is good for everyday use.iv.) There's no point complaining that games work slowly because this is NOT a gaming laptop. You cannot buy a motorcycle and then complain that it does not fly. If you want a good gaming laptop, shell out more than 1 lakh. The onboard graphics on this is roughly as powerful as a GeForce GTX 765m SLI, a GPU that was released in 2013. If you're playing games from that era, you can play them at 1080p at high settings. Don't expect today's games to run well.v.) I have found no problems such as poor sound quality (I use earphones most of the time), battery draining quickly etc. After cashback, I got this laptop for Rs. 43,690.5 .vi.) The build quality isn't very strong. So, use the laptop with care. Be gentle when opening and closing the lid. Place the laptop inside a bag when not in use. Otherwise, constant use can damage the shell.Edit (15-Nov-23): After a year of heavy use, the LCD cover, bezel (the strip around the monitor) and the back case got damaged. I didn't drop the laptop. Just heavy use. At first, I only saw the damage on the first two components. I registered a complaint with Lenovo online. They sent an engineer and replaced those two components under warranty (no extra charge). However, the damage on the third component is something I only observed when the engineer who came to my house for repairs showed it to me. I asked him to contact Lenovo and send the third part too but they said they won't cover it under warranty. I think if I found it the first time around they would have sent all 3 components. Anyway, overall I'm still happy for now. The back case isn't much of a problem for now once the screws are placed in. It just looks like a crack.Edit (18-Oct-24): In one more year, again, the body has deteriorated significantly. Cracks everywhere, monitor hinge loose etc. Have to spend 8k on repairs. If you're looking for long lasting durable laptops, a Thinkpad might be a better option. You will save on costs in the long run. These cheap plastic body laptops have these issues of cracking, hinges getting loose or breaking etc. if you're a heavy user. You don't have to drop the laptop for shell damage. Just opening and closing the lid and moving the laptop around frequently can do it. The hardware is good. The durability is poor.Edit (21-Mar-25): Once again, the monitor hinge has come off even though the internal hardware and functioning of the laptop is perfectly fine. This kind of durability is a dealbreaker. Why put great hardware in such a crap body.Edit (30-Mar-25): After 2.5 years of use, I have had to purchase a new laptop due to the monitor hinge breaking 3-4 times. This is a recurring issue with these laptops. You can look it up online. Hundreds of complaints regarding this. Asus Vivobooks have better build quality.
